WESLEY S. KNOLL

Wes Knoll joined the LCWater team in the fall of 2015. Wes is a 5th generation Colorado native from Evergreen, Colorado. Growing up in the cyclical drought of Colorado, Wes became interested in the role water had in shaping various Colorado communities. This interest led him to Montana State University where he majored in Political Science and minored in Water Resources. He then attended law school at the University of Oregon where he graduated with a Certificate in Environmental and Natural Resources Law. During law school Wes worked with the local municipal utility on water quality issues, with Trout Unlimited on water banking issues in Idaho, and assisted his water law professor, Adell Amos, with research and editing for Water Law in a Nutshell, 5th ed. Wes represents clients in matters including adjudication of new surface and groundwater rights, change of water rights, augmentation plans, purchase and sale of water rights, contracts, real property transactions, land use issues, and representation of special districts, municipalities, and not-for-profit corporations.
